Stadium nearby 45, Jalan SS 7/2, Ss 7, 47301 Petaling Jaya, Selangor, Malaysia

 
Showing 1 - 3 of 3

Stadium

Approx 1.39 KM away

Address: Selangor, Malaysia

Stadium

Approx 1.39 KM away

Address: Selangor, Malaysia

Stadium

Approx 1.39 KM away

Address: Selangor, Malaysia

Showing 1 - 3 of 3